**14:22 — Snapshot drift detected.** The Lintwood UI pipeline flagged 412 failing snapshots after the Quillbar component library bumped its theme tokens. New folks: this is expected whenever design primitives change, but our gate treats any diff as a failure. Mira approved a bulk re-baseline at 14:40 once she confirmed the diffs were purely cosmetic. The re-baseline job completed cleanly and its identifier is recorded below.

build token for kagaf-hahof: htk14_9d3d4d26d7d8de

The drift affects retention windows and the compaction trigger ratio, which matters for this review because compacted segments are our mechanism for purging superseded records containing sensitive payloads. We believe the divergence was introduced during an emergency capacity change in March and never reconciled. For reference, the broker cluster is presently running with the following configuration.

service settings:
PRAIX_LOG_LEVEL=error
PRAIX_METRICS_HOST=metrics.praix.qorvelcorp.corp
PRAIX_POOL_SIZE=16

// DEPLOYBOT_POLL_INTERVAL_MS — polling cadence for Glintrail's deploy
// status bot in the #releases channel. Do not lower below 5000;
// the Coppervane API rate-limits aggressively and the bot gets
// muted for an hour. Support: if the bot goes quiet, check rate-limit
// headers first, then restart via the ops console. Changes here must
// ship through the standard pipeline, no hotfixes. Tag any incident
// report with the bot's current build token, printed below.

pipeline stamp: htk9_ce63042d9

Capacity planning: Driftwell orphaned-resource sweeper. The sweeper now scans three regions per cycle, and each full pass touches roughly 1.2M records in the Halverson metadata store. At current growth, scan time will exceed the 20-minute budget by Q3. We propose raising batch size and shortening the grace window for unreferenced volumes, while keeping the deletion quorum conservative to avoid a repeat of the Tessmark incident. Marguerite will own the rollout. The constants we intend to ship next cycle are as follows.

tuning constants:
QUOTAS = {
    "druwyn": 5,
    "holix": 5,
    "zorath": 5,
    "holwyn": 10,
}